A record number of two-year-olds remain in contention following third declarations for Victoria's richest juvenile race at Caulfield.

The Group One has 105 horses remaining after the third round of acceptances on Tuesday, 21 more than the previous record last year and in 2013.

The Lindsay Park training team of David and and Tom Dabernig have the largest contingent paying up for 25.

Included in their team are , Pelican and Swan Island who are among entries for the Group Three Chairman's Stakes at Caulfield on Saturday.

Swan Island is also entered at on Friday night and at on Saturday with Art Collection also holding an entry in Adelaide.

Tony McEvoy has 11 entries remaining for the February 23 race while dual winner has 10 and having nine.

Final Declarations for the $1.5 million race are taken on February 19.
